#include "config.h"
#include "SVGCursorElement.h"

#include "CSSCursorImageValue.h"
#include "Document.h"
#include "SVGNames.h"
#include "SVGStringList.h"
#include <wtf/IsoMallocInlines.h>
#include <wtf/NeverDestroyed.h>

namespace WebCore {

WTF_MAKE_ISO_ALLOCATED_IMPL(SVGCursorElement);

inline SVGCursorElement::SVGCursorElement(const QualifiedName& tagName, Document& document)
    : SVGElement(tagName, document)
    , SVGExternalResourcesRequired(this)
    , SVGTests(this)
    , SVGURIReference(this)
{
    ASSERT(hasTagName(SVGNames::cursorTag));
    registerAttributes();
}

Ref<SVGCursorElement> SVGCursorElement::create(const QualifiedName& tagName, Document& document)
{
    return adoptRef(*new SVGCursorElement(tagName, document));
}

SVGCursorElement::~SVGCursorElement()
{
    for (auto& client : m_clients)
        client->cursorElementRemoved(*this);
}

void SVGCursorElement::registerAttributes()
{
    auto& registry = attributeRegistry();
    if (!registry.isEmpty())
        return;
    registry.registerAttribute<SVGNames::xAttr, &SVGCursorElement::m_x>();
    registry.registerAttribute<SVGNames::yAttr, &SVGCursorElement::m_y>();
}

void SVGCursorElement::parseAttribute(const QualifiedName& name, const AtomicString& value)
{
    SVGParsingError parseError = NoError;

    if (name == SVGNames::xAttr)
        m_x.setValue(SVGLengthValue::construct(LengthModeWidth, value, parseError));
    else if (name == SVGNames::yAttr)
        m_y.setValue(SVGLengthValue::construct(LengthModeHeight, value, parseError));

    reportAttributeParsingError(parseError, name, value);

    SVGElement::parseAttribute(name, value);
    SVGTests::parseAttribute(name, value);
    SVGExternalResourcesRequired::parseAttribute(name, value);
    SVGURIReference::parseAttribute(name, value);
}

void SVGCursorElement::addClient(CSSCursorImageValue& value)
{
    m_clients.add(&value);
}

void SVGCursorElement::removeClient(CSSCursorImageValue& value)
{
    m_clients.remove(&value);
}

void SVGCursorElement::svgAttributeChanged(const QualifiedName& attrName)
{
    if (isKnownAttribute(attrName)) {
        InstanceInvalidationGuard guard(*this);
        for (auto& client : m_clients)
            client->cursorElementChanged(*this);
        return;
    }

    SVGElement::svgAttributeChanged(attrName);
}

void SVGCursorElement::addSubresourceAttributeURLs(ListHashSet<URL>& urls) const
{
    SVGElement::addSubresourceAttributeURLs(urls);

    addSubresourceURL(urls, document().completeURL(href()));
}

}
